The bill prohibits all China workers from entering the United States for ten years. Its amendment 1884 further strengthens the provision of allowing previously arrived immigrants to leave the United States and return to China, and at the same time clarifies that the law is applicable to all China people, regardless of their nationality. 1892, which was extended by en:Geary for ten years, and 1902 cancelled the deadline. This bill was repealed by the magnuson Act (en:Magnuson Act) passed in 1943, which allowed the annual quota of Chinese immigrants in 105. However, large-scale Chinese immigrants did not follow, until the Immigration and Nationality Service Act (the Immigration and Nationality Service Act of EN: 1965) was a response to a large number of Chinese who moved to the western United States because of the internal turmoil in China and the job opportunities for railway construction. This is the first immigration law for a specific ethnic group passed by the United States. Although the bill was repealed a long time ago, it has always been a part of the American code. Even today, although all parts of it have been abolished for a long time, the title of Chapter 8 and Chapter 7 is "Exclusion from China". It is the only chapter in Chapter 8 (Foreigners and Nationality), Chapter 15, which is completely aimed at a specific nation or ethnic group.
[Edit this paragraph] The attitude of the Qing government in China
Since 1876, the Qing government has been protesting against the persecution of overseas Chinese in the United States. In this regard, the US government either shirks its responsibility by not interfering in local affairs, or simply ignores it. Under the oppression of foreign powers, the Qing government was well aware of the serious consequences of American exclusion from China and dared not take retaliatory measures. Instead, they gave in step by step, signed a new treaty with the United States in 1884, and banned Chinese workers from going to the United States in 10. This treaty marks the Qing government's recognition of the legality of the American Chinese Exclusion Act, and makes the American government feel that China is weak and bullying, and Chinese exclusion is becoming more and more unscrupulous. 1On April 27th, 904, the US Congress passed a motion to extend all Chinese Exclusion Acts indefinitely, which aroused great indignation among the people of China. 1905 The boycott of American goods broke out, forcing the American government to order the relaxation of entry restrictions for teachers, students, businessmen and tourists, but Chinese workers were still prohibited from entering the country as before. 1924 and 1930 successively promulgated new immigration regulations to prevent China workers from entering the United States.
